Page 1 of 1
Umlaute im Suche Plugin
Posted: Sun Sep 17, 2006 2:44 pm
by Matthias2
Hallo,
via Boardsuche konnte ich leider nichts finden.
Dieses Blog
http://blog.duesipixel.de betreibe ich mit Serendipity 0.9.1 und dem Sidebar Suchplugin 1.0.
Umlaute werden in der Suche nicht berücksichtigt. Kennt jm dieses Problem? Wie kann man das beheben?
Ist das "Searches comments on quicksearch" Eventplugin eine Erweiterung für o.g. Plugin?
Vielen Dank und Grüße
Matthias
Re: Umlaute im Suche Plugin
Posted: Sun Sep 17, 2006 4:01 pm
by garvinhicking
Hi!
Serendipty nutzt die Volltext-Suchefunktionalität der Datenbank.
Welche MySQL-Version hast Du? Sind die Zeichensätze dort korrekt konfiguriert? Du nutzt ja UTF-8 als Zeichensatz, dass müsste dein MySQL unerstützen können.
Viele Grüße,
Garvin
Posted: Sun Sep 17, 2006 9:20 pm
by Matthias2
Hallo und danke für die Antwort.
MySQL Version: 4.0.25
in der DB schauen die Umlaute so aus
"Accesskeys für Alle"
Hatte ich was falsch gemacht? Muss ich was ändern?
Posted: Sun Sep 17, 2006 9:29 pm
by Matthias2
Ich habe den Zeichensatz via phpMyadmin umgstellt, nun sehe ich die Umlaute in der Datenbank richtig über diese Oberfläche, ändert aber bei der Suche nichts.
Unter dem Punkt Servervariablen und -einstellungen steht bei "character sets":
latin1 big5 cp1251 cp1257 croat czech danish dec8 dos estonia euc_kr gb2312 gbk german1 greek hebrew hp8 hungarian koi8_ru koi8_ukr latin1_de latin2 latin5 sjis swe7 tis620 ujis usa7 win1250 win1251ukr win1251
Hilft diese Info weiter?
Posted: Mon Sep 18, 2006 11:35 am
by garvinhicking
Hi!
MySQL unter 4.1 unterstützt keine UTF-8 Collations mit Volltextsuche. Du musst daher MySQL aktualisieren um die Suche nutzen zu können, sorry.
Viele Grüße,
Garvin
Posted: Mon Sep 18, 2006 4:18 pm
by stm999999999
hm, ich nutze für mein blog "Verbunden mit MySQL 4.1.9-log" laut myphpadmin.
Und ich kann wunderbar nach Umlautwörtern suchen, etwa nach "schön"
http://blog.stephan.manske-net.de/index ... sch%C3%B6n
und mein blog läuft mit UTF-8
OK, hat sich erledigt: Ich las "mysql bis 4.1 ..."
Posted: Mon Sep 18, 2006 7:46 pm
by Matthias2
Vielen Dank für diese Information. Ist meine Version so outdated, dass dieses Problem noch keiner hatte?
Ich habe eine entspr. Anfrage an meinen Hoster gestellt.
Dankeschön.
Posted: Mon Sep 18, 2006 8:07 pm
by garvinhicking
Hi!
Nun, derzeit "production ready" ist MySQL 5.1. 4.0 ist gut 4 Jahre alt, das kann man also schon als "outdated" ansehen.
Erst MySQL 4.1 war wirklich UTF-8 kompatibel; in unserer jugendlichen Unvernunft gingen wir davon aus, dass neue s9y Benutzer die UTF-8 wählen auch eine fähige Datenbank haben. Das ist aber nicht so richtig gut dokumentiert, gebe ich zu. :-/
Viele Grüße,
Garvin